    yeah, I have, but the gist is that you need to cut the fender lips out up front, install flares, then cut the lips of the flares out, the rear is the same, although I suppose you could flip the inner lip out instead of shaving it down like I did. The point is, it takes some work and patience if you want tires that will actually hold up to your power levels. I'll be fitting a 255 bfg R1 semislick this winter which is about as wide as your average 265/75 so I'll let you know how that goes. It comes down to if you want lower offsets with narrower tires and more camber or slightly higher offset but some meat on the tires, I've done both, I had 17x9.5 +30 work vsxx with 235 toyos on them with a slight stretch, I've had 17x9 +27 5zigens with 255/40s falkens on them, currently on 18x9s +30 with 245/40 NT-05s that are wider than my 255s were smh... and then for next track season as I mentioned I'll have huge slicks on the car. The point is you can go for super style or super function, or try and find the happy medium in between which is what I've tried, functional camber levels to clear wheels with beefy tires with a nice offset so it's not sunk.
